Is 4 shots of tequila a lot?
The ordinary individual would get slightly intoxicated on tequila after two shots, severely drunk after four shots, and very drunk for anything more. Of course, this is very vulnerable to many various circumstances, such as weight, mood, age, and even alcohol tolerance.
Is tequila stronger than vodka?
When it comes to the subject of whether tequila is stronger than vodka, the answer is that it really depends. When faced with a challenging situation, no one spirit is inevitably stronger than another spirit. Tequila and vodka will have the same strength for the most part, as 40 percent ABV (or 80 proof) is the acknowledged benchmark for the vast majority of spirits in the market today.
Why does tequila make you blackout?
Binge drinking is when you consume a large amount of alcohol in a short period of time. Your liver cannot keep up and cannot process the alcohol quickly enough. As a result, your blood alcohol content (BAC) rises fast, and you eventually pass out from the effects of alcohol.
What kind of drunk is tequila?
It is a depressive, despite the fact that you may have witnessed folks who were drinking tequila become noisy and excessively enthusiastic. This is due to the fact that it contains ethanol, a kind of alcohol that contains the same intoxicating element found in wine, beer, and other alcoholic beverages.
